Here’s a video making the rounds that shows three upcoming phones - HTC Coke, LG Lotus (LX600) and the Blackberry Thunder (aka 9500). This is the first video I’ve seen of the touch screen Blackberry and it confirms earlier reports that the touch implementation is challenged in at least two ways. First, the screen operates by a lot of tough pushing. Secondly the scrolling appears to require more effort and not the smooth finger movements that competitors use. Most impressive is the phone’s implementation of screen rotation. The Blackberry Thunder can be rotated 360 around and the screen will rotate fully to any position that the phone is held. This model is rumored for an appearance on Verizon at some unknown future time in the fourth quarter of 2008.
